What are the health benefits of parsley?
Parsley is a delicious aromatic herb and equipped with excellent health benefits. On his Instagram profile, naturopath Yohan Mannone (@yohan_naturopath) revealed 4 virtues that will convince you to eat parsley more often.
- A source of vitamins. They are necessary for the construction and proper functioning of our body. According to naturopaths, parsley gives us a good dose. It’s aromatic rich “vitamin K, vitamin A and vitamin C”, he says in his post on Instagram.
- Remineralizing. Parsley fills us with minerals, which – let’s remember – are necessary for the life of our body tissues (epithelial, connective, muscle and nerve tissue). The aromatic plant is, according to the expert, good source “iron, magnesium, potassium and calcium”.
- Diuretic and digestive. A health specialist explains that parsley “stimulates gastric secretion and helps to eliminate flatulence.”
- Antioxidant. Thanks to this property, parsley protects body cells from damage caused by free radicals. That’s not all, the naturopath adds that parsley is “super antioxidant it also has anti-inflammatory properties thanks to the content of chlorophyll, flavonoids, lutein and beta-carotene”.
Parsley: advice from a naturopath for proper consumption
In addition to the health benefits of parsley, naturopath Yohan Mannone shared some tips for its consumption in his Instagram post. Food experts recommend eating it raw, “in your salads and drinks”. When it comes to salads, you can add a few pinches of parsley to the ingredients or make it the main element as in Lebanese tabule. As for drinks, parsley is especially tasty infusions or smoothies.
